Koenigsegg Jesko Absolut – Targeting 310+ MPH
When Christian von Koenigsegg sets his sights on a goal, the automotive world holds its breath. The Koenigsegg Jesko Absolut isn’t just another hypercar; it’s a meticulously crafted missile designed with one singular purpose: to be the fastest production car on Earth. This isn’t a mere aspiration for 2025; it’s an ongoing, highly anticipated endeavor.
The Absolut, a sleeker, more aerodynamically optimized sibling to the track-focused Jesko Attack, epitomizes Koenigsegg’s “Absolut” philosophy—meaning it is the ultimate expression for straight-line speed. At its heart lies a monstrous twin-turbocharged 5.0-liter V8 engine, an absolute masterpiece of Swedish engineering. When fed E85 ethanol, this powerplant unleashes an astounding 1,600 horsepower and 1,106 lb-ft of torque. What’s truly remarkable is how this immense power is paired with an astonishingly light curb weight of just 3,064 pounds (1,390 kg). The power-to-weight ratio is simply mind-boggling, a critical factor in achieving hyper-elevated velocities.
From an expert perspective, the Jesko Absolut’s true genius lies in its aero package. Unlike its high-downforce Jesko Attack counterpart, the Absolut sacrifices some cornering grip for minimal drag. Every curve, every vent, every millimeter of its carbon fiber bodywork has been sculpted to slice through the air with unparalleled efficiency. The rear is elongated, the massive rear wing replaced by two smaller vertical fins, and even the wheel designs are optimized for reduced turbulence. This meticulous attention to detail is what makes its theoretical top speed of 310 mph (499 km/h) not just a marketing claim, but a very real and highly probable target.
While the official, independently verified 300+ mph run has been challenging to achieve due to finding a suitable, long enough stretch of road, the Absolut’s existing records are strong indicators of its capability. Its sibling has already demonstrated blistering acceleration, including the fastest time from 0-249 mph (400 km/h) and back to zero, completing the feat in a blistering 27.83 seconds. For 2025, the anticipation for the Absolut’s definitive top-speed run is palpable among automotive enthusiasts and investment-grade automobile collectors alike. It’s not a question of if it can do it, but when and where. This machine is a testament to the relentless pursuit of perfection in bespoke hypercar engineering.
Yangwang U9 Xtreme – 308 MPH (A New Electric Era)
This is perhaps the most significant development in the electric hypercar market for 2025. The arrival of the Yangwang U9 Xtreme marks an undeniable paradigm shift. In a monumental moment for the history of high-performance electric vehicles (EVs), September 2025 saw the U9 Xtreme officially record a verified top speed of 308 mph (496 km/h) on a closed runway in Germany. This isn’t just fast for an EV; this is genuinely world-beating performance, putting it squarely among the fastest production cars ever built, regardless of powertrain.
Yangwang, a luxury sub-brand of Chinese automotive giant BYD, has effectively shattered preconceived notions about electric performance. The U9 Xtreme is a technological marvel, powered by four independent electric motors, one for each wheel, collectively churning out an earth-shattering 3,000 horsepower. This unprecedented power output is managed by an extremely advanced 1,200-volt electrical architecture – a stark contrast to the common 400-volt setups found in most consumer EVs. This higher voltage allows for more efficient power delivery, faster charging, and enables such extreme performance.
Beyond raw power, the U9 Xtreme integrates BYD’s innovative DiSus-X intelligent body control system, which not only enhances handling but likely plays a crucial role in maintaining stability at these unprecedented speeds. The limited production run of just 30 models, with prices anticipated to start north of $250,000, solidifies its status as an exclusive, ultra-luxury EV. From a market perspective, the U9 Xtreme is a powerful statement about Chinese EV innovation and its capabilities at the absolute pinnacle of automotive engineering. It’s not just a fast car; it’s a harbinger of the next-gen EV performance that will define the future.
SSC Tuatara – 295 MPH (American Power Resurgent)
The story of the SSC Tuatara is one of ambition, controversy, and ultimately, undeniable triumph for American hypercar manufacturers. The quest for ultimate speed often comes with intense scrutiny, and the Tuatara’s journey has been well-documented. While initial claims in October 2020 of achieving an astounding 331 mph were later retracted due to GPS errors, the team at SSC (Shelby SuperCars) persevered, determined to prove their engineering mettle.
By early 2022, rigorous, independently verified testing saw the Tuatara achieve a confirmed top speed of 295 mph (475 km/h). Let’s be clear: 295 mph is not “not exactly slow”; it is an absolutely blistering speed that places the Tuatara among the elite few. It’s a testament to the raw power and meticulous design coming out of Washington State.
Underneath its aggressive, aerodynamically sculpted body, the Tuatara houses a bespoke, twin-turbocharged 5.9-liter V8 engine. This powerhouse is capable of producing an incredible 1,750 horsepower when running on E85 ethanol, or 1,350 hp on premium pump gas. This level of power, combined with its lightweight carbon fiber monocoque chassis, allows for truly explosive acceleration and a relentless surge towards its top speed.
From my vantage point, the Tuatara represents a distinct philosophy in the hypercar world: a focus on pure, unadulterated speed with minimal hybrid complexity. It showcases the enduring prowess of American engine building and a commitment to pushing boundaries. For those seeking extreme performance vehicles with a distinctly American flavor, the Tuatara stands as a formidable contender, cementing SSC’s place in the pantheon of speed. The integrity of their speed validation protocols has also set a new standard for future record attempts.
Bugatti Tourbillon – 277 MPH (The Hybridized Future of Luxury)
For anyone who grew up idolizing the Bugatti Veyron’s audacious pursuit of speed, the new Bugatti Tourbillon is a powerful callback and a bold leap forward. Announced in mid-2024 and firmly cementing its place as a 2025 icon, the Tourbillon carries the spirit of its predecessors while embracing the future of hybrid hypercar technology. This isn’t just a car; it’s a horological masterpiece on wheels, referencing the intricate, precision-engineered tourbillon mechanism found in the world’s finest watches.
Powering this $3.8 million (estimated, for the US market) luxury missile is a truly monumental 8.3-liter naturally aspirated V16 engine, paired with three electric motors. This complex yet harmonious powertrain delivers a staggering combined output of 1,800 horsepower. The raw, visceral scream of that V16, combined with the instantaneous torque of the electric motors, propels the Tourbillon from 0-60 mph in under 2.0 seconds, before surging towards an electronically limited top speed of 277 mph (446 km/h).
What makes the Tourbillon particularly fascinating from an expert perspective is Bugatti’s commitment to maintaining their legacy of unparalleled luxury and craftsmanship while integrating cutting-edge hybridization. The interior is a symphony of exposed mechanical components, exquisite materials, and a complete absence of digital screens on the main dashboard, instead relying on meticulously crafted analog gauges that rotate with the steering wheel. This approach appeals directly to the ultra-luxury car market and those who appreciate bespoke supercar manufacturers that blend tradition with innovation.
Given Bugatti’s history of releasing even faster iterations (like the Chiron Super Sport 300+), it’s highly probable we’ll see an even more extreme version of the Tourbillon in the years to come, further pushing the boundaries of what a road-legal car can achieve. The Tourbillon isn’t just a car; it’s a mobile art piece and a significant statement on the future direction of V16 engine revival in a hybrid context.
Hennessey Venom F5 – 272 MPH (Pure American Muscle Unleashed)
America’s presence in the top-speed game is stronger than ever, and Hennessey Performance Engineering, based in Texas, is a key player. The Hennessey Venom F5 is a testament to John Hennessey’s singular vision: to build the world’s most powerful and fastest road car. For 2025, the F5 continues to stand as a beacon of raw, unadulterated power and relentless ambition.
At its core is Hennessey’s “Fury” engine – a monstrous 6.6-liter twin-turbocharged V8. This purpose-built engine delivers an earth-shattering 1,817 horsepower and 1,193 lb-ft of torque. Coupled with a lightweight carbon fiber monocoque chassis, this translates to blistering performance: 0-60 mph in a mere 2.6 seconds, and a validated top speed of 272 mph (438 km/h).
However, Hennessey’s ambitions don’t stop there. Their stated goal has always been to break the 300 mph barrier with the F5, and for 2025, this goal remains a driving force. From my experience, achieving such speeds requires not just immense power but also incredibly refined aerodynamics and uncompromising stability, which Hennessey has meticulously honed. The F5 is designed for minimal drag, featuring a sleek, purposeful body devoid of superfluous elements.
The Venom F5 is a vehicle for true driving purists, focusing on the visceral experience of speed and power. It’s a track-focused hypercar that’s also road-legal, offering an unparalleled level of engagement. For collectors and enthusiasts seeking extreme performance vehicles that embody American ingenuity and a no-compromise approach to speed, the F5 is an undeniable magnet. Its ongoing pursuit of the 300 mph mark makes it one of the most exciting sagas in the hypercar world.
Bugatti Mistral – 270 MPH (The Last W16 Convertible)
The Bugatti Mistral holds a unique and poignant place on this list: it is the fastest convertible car in the world, and more significantly, it is the final Bugatti model to ever feature the iconic 8.0-liter quad-turbocharged W16 engine. As we look at 2025, the Mistral represents the glorious swansong of an engine that defined an era of hypercar performance.
This breathtaking roadster delivers a formidable 1,600 horsepower and 1,180 lb-ft of torque, with power channeled to all four wheels via a seven-speed automatic gearbox. Its blistering top speed of 270 mph (435 km/h) is an engineering marvel, especially for an open-top vehicle. Creating a convertible that can maintain such stability and aerodynamic integrity at nearly 300 mph is an incredibly complex challenge, requiring extensive reinforcement and meticulous airflow management to prevent buffeting and maintain structural rigidity.
From an expert standpoint, the Mistral is not just about speed; it’s about celebrating a legacy. It’s an investment-grade automobile that represents the end of an unparalleled automotive chapter. Its exclusivity, with all 99 examples quickly spoken for despite a price tag approaching $5 million, underscores its significance as a collectible hypercar. The experience of driving at 270 mph with the wind in your hair (or, more realistically, with a very firm grip on the wheel and a helmet on a closed course) is an utterly unique proposition, making the Mistral a pinnacle of open-top speed records and a fitting tribute to the legendary W16 engine legacy.
Rimac Nevera R – 267 MPH (Electrifying Evolution)
Croatia’s Rimac Automobili has rapidly established itself as a force in the electric powertrain development space, and the Nevera R is the latest, even more insane evolution of their groundbreaking electric hypercar. The standard Nevera was already a sensation, but the “R” variant, rolling into 2025, pushes the boundaries further.
Power from its four electric motors, one for each wheel, has been bumped from an already staggering 1,914 horsepower to an astonishing 2,107 horsepower. This surge in power has propelled its top speed from 256 mph to an incredible 267 mph (430 km/h). But the Nevera R isn’t just about top speed; its acceleration figures are simply absurd: 0-60 mph in a blistering 1.7 seconds, making it one of the fastest accelerating cars on the planet.
As an expert in the field, I view Rimac as more than just a car manufacturer; they are a technology powerhouse. Their involvement with Porsche and the Bugatti-Rimac joint venture highlights their influence on the future of hypercar innovation. The Nevera R showcases the absolute potential of electric propulsion, not just in raw numbers, but in the intelligent distribution of torque to each wheel for unparalleled traction and control. This vehicle sets new benchmarks for Croatian automotive engineering and reinforces the idea that electric power is not just an alternative, but a superior pathway to extreme performance in many respects. A rematch of the Nevera R against other lightweight speed demons would undoubtedly be a spectacle.

McLaren Speedtail – 250 MPH (The Hyper-GT Redefined)
McLaren, a brand synonymous with track-focused performance, created the Speedtail with a slightly different objective: to be the ultimate “Hyper-GT.” While not designed to chase outright world records in the same vein as a Jesko Absolut, its 250 mph (402 km/h) top speed still makes it the fastest road car McLaren has ever built—surpassing even the legendary F1 and the new flagship W1 (which “only” reaches 237 mph).
The Speedtail is a spiritual successor to the McLaren F1, particularly in its unique three-seat central driving position, with passengers flanking the driver. Its aerodynamic design principles are paramount; the bodywork is incredibly slippery, devoid of conventional drag-inducing wings or spoilers, instead utilizing active aero elements and flexible carbon fiber ailerons that seamlessly integrate into the body. This “streamliner” aesthetic isn’t just for show; it’s crucial for achieving its incredible velocity with its 1,036 horsepower hybrid powertrain.
As an expert, I see the Speedtail as a masterclass in elegant, functional design. It’s a car that prioritizes effortless, high-speed cruising in supreme luxury. It’s for the discerning owner who wants to cover vast distances at warp speed, carrying two companions, in a car that looks like it’s been ripped straight from a futuristic cyberpunk film. The Speedtail perfectly encapsulates the hyper-GT segment and stands as a modern icon of McLaren F1 heritage.
Koenigsegg Regera – 250 MPH (Single-Gear Revolution)
Sharing the 250 mph top speed with the Speedtail, the Koenigsegg Regera is another marvel from the Swedish brand, but with an entirely different approach to power delivery. The Regera, launched as a “mega-GT,” marries a twin-turbo V8 engine with three electric motors, producing a combined output of 1,500 horsepower and 1,475 lb-ft of torque.
What truly sets the Regera apart is its groundbreaking Koenigsegg Direct Drive (KDD) system. Unlike any other car on this list, the Regera largely operates without a traditional multi-gear transmission. After an initial, very low-ratio fixed gear that gets it off the line (more like a reduction gear), the car primarily uses a single gear for its entire speed range, from around 30 mph all the way up to its 250 mph (402 km/h) top speed. This system eliminates the weight and energy losses associated with a conventional gearbox, resulting in astonishing efficiency and direct power delivery.
From an engineering perspective, KDD is a bold, radical solution that challenges conventional wisdom. It showcases Koenigsegg’s commitment to innovative hybrid systems and pushing the boundaries of automotive driveline technology. The Regera, therefore, represents a unique blend of extreme power, Swedish engineering excellence, and a surprisingly smooth, seamless driving experience for a car of its caliber. It’s a statement that there’s always a new way to solve old problems, especially in the pursuit of speed.
Aston Martin Valkyrie – 250 MPH (F1 on the Road)
On appearance alone, many might question the legality of the Aston Martin Valkyrie on public roads. Designed in collaboration with Red Bull Advanced Technologies and motorsport maestro Adrian Newey, it looks less like a street-legal car and more like a purpose-built Le Mans prototype or even an F1 racer. Yet, incredibly, you can indeed drive this machine on the street, making it one of the most extreme road-going vehicles in existence.
Powering the Valkyrie is a magnificent 6.5-liter naturally aspirated hybrid V12 engine, developed by Cosworth, producing an awe-inspiring 1,160 horsepower. This highly strung, high-revving engine, combined with a lightweight construction that sees the car weigh just over a ton, propels the Valkyrie from 0-60 mph in a blistering 2.5 seconds, with a top speed of 250 mph (402 km/h).
My take on the Valkyrie is that it’s a profound statement on F1 technology transfer to the road. Every element, from its radical underfloor aerodynamics that generate immense downforce to its minimalist, driver-focused cockpit, screams motorsport. It’s not just fast; it’s an immersive, almost brutal driving experience that demands respect. For those seeking the closest possible connection to a professional racing car experience within a (technically) street-legal package, the Aston Martin Valkyrie stands as an unparalleled example of aerodynamic efficiency in hypercars and a truly limited edition supercar.
